Аннотация: Polysiloxanes containing nonchelating 3-aminopropyl and chelating N-(2-aminoethyl)-3-aminopropyl groups with the degree of functionalization of 28 and 24%, respectively, were prepared by sol–gel synthesis. The polysiloxanes obtained showed comparable activity in sorption of Pd(II), Pt(IV), Fe(III), Cd(II), Zn(II), Co(II), Ni(II), Cu(II), Mn(II), Pb(II), Ca(II), and Mg(II) ions from model multicomponent solutions. At pH 3,3-aminopropylpolysiloxane selectively takes up platinoid ions. The chelating structure of N-(2-aminoethyl)-3-aminopropyl groups leads to a decrease in the selectivity of the interaction with Pd(II) ions but increases the affinity for Fe(III), Ni(II), and Cu(II). Preconcentration in the dynamic mode allows quantitative sorption of Pd(II) and Pt(IV), followed by virtually quantitative elution of the metal ions from the sorbent surface.
